  • All of the icons are internet explorer. how do i restore the correct icons to match the program?

    All of the shortcut icons on my HP G60 computer are Internet Explorer.  Also, the icons on the taskbar and the startup listing are also Internet Explorer.  I have tried to restore the computer, but I got the error # 0x8000ffff.  I have worked and worked, but i cannot get the shortcut icons to revert back to the default settings.  Any help appreciated

    Hi,
    This is from Microsoft support:
    If for any reason, one or more icons are not showing correctly, you can repair by rebuilding the icon cache. Icon cache is a hidden file located at the Local Folder. Here is how to do it:
    1. Open Windows Explorer (any folder/drive).
    2. As the IconCache is a hidden file, you need to enable “Show hidden files” option to see the same. To do this, head over to Tools > Folder Options, switch to View tab, and finally enable Show Hidden files, folders, and drives option.
    3. Now navigate to C:\Users\username\AppData\Local  folder and then delete IconCache.db file.
    4. Reboot your computer to rebuild the icon cache.
    5. All icons should be displayed correct now.
    But, before rebuilding icon cache, I'd suggest you to create a restore point .

  • Help!    Flashing desk top icons and screen de-selection

    While in any screen, my desk top icons will flash off for a second or 2 and then back on. At the same time, the screen I am in will be de-selected. Anyone have a cure or experience this?
    Thanks

    Hi Wayne, and a warm welcome to the forums!
    It's likely some 3rd Party APP that got broken by the recent QT or Security update.
    Stuffit AVR has been a big one, if you have that use the Pref Pane to turn it off, but others have been implicated too. Check System Preferences for a Stuffit Pref Pane and disable AVR.
    One way to test is to Safe Boot from the HD, (holding Shift key down at bootup), run Disk Utility in Applications>Utilities, then highlight your drive, click on Repair Permissions, Test for action in Safe Mode...
    Reboot, test again.
    If it only does it in Regular Boot, then it is some 3rd party add-on, Check System Preferences>Accounts>Login Items window to see if it or something relevant is listed.
    Check the System Preferences>Other Row, for 3rd party Pref Panes.
    Also look in these if they exist, some are invisible...
    /private/var/run/StartupItems
    /Library/StartupItems
    /System/Library/StartupItems
